Morphology and electrical properties of polylactide / natural rubber blend filled with conductive nano carbon
Polylactide (PLA) is a biodegradable polymer that has potential to replace petroleum based polymers which currently used in conductive polymer composite (CPC). In order to develop environmentally friendly conductive polymer composites, in this research PLA was melt blended with natural rubber (NR),...
